Comparison Table: Top Email Marketing Platforms
| Platform | Best For | Free Plan | Starting Price (Paid) | Automation Level | Key Integrations | Ease of Use |
| Mailchimp | Beginners & small businesses | Yes | ~$13/month | Moderate | Shopify, WooCommerce, WordPress, Zapier | Very Easy |
| Brevo (Sendinblue) | Budget users & SMBs | Yes (unlimited contacts) | ~$25/month | High | Shopify, WordPress, HubSpot, CRM tools | Easy |
| ConvertKit | Creators, coaches & bloggers | Yes | ~$15/month | High | Gumroad, Shopify, WordPress, Kajabi | Very Easy |
| MailerLite | Freelancers & startups | Yes | ~$10/month | Moderate | Shopify, WooCommerce, Zapier, WordPress | Very Easy |
| GetResponse | Businesses needing funnels & webinars | Yes | ~$19/month | High | Shopify, WooCommerce, BigCommerce | Medium |
| ActiveCampaign | Advanced automation & CRM-driven teams | No (14-day trial) | ~$49/month | Very High | Salesforce, Shopify, WordPress, Zapier | Medium |
| HubSpot Email Marketing | All-in-one CRM + marketing | Yes | ~$20/month | High | HubSpot CRM, Shopify, WordPress | Medium |
| Moosend | Startups & eCommerce beginners | Yes (trial) | ~$9/month | Moderate–High | Shopify, WooCommerce, WordPress | Easy |

2. Brevo (Sendinblue)

Brevo, formerly known as Sendinblue, is a highly reliable platform known for providing powerful email marketing features at an affordable cost. It stands out for offering unlimited contacts, which is a major advantage compared to other top email marketing platforms that restrict free plans based on subscriber count. Brevo’s automation builder is easy to use, allowing you to set up personalized workflows, segmentation, and customer journeys that boost engagement. It also offers SMS marketing, WhatsApp campaigns, and live chat, all in one interface, making it a complete communication suite for businesses. The drag-and-drop editor allows you to create visually appealing emails, while its transactional email service ensures fast delivery for order confirmations and OTPs.
Brevo also includes real-time analytics, enabling marketers to refine campaigns based on performance. Its budget-friendly pricing, combined with multi-channel capabilities, makes Brevo an excellent choice for small and medium-sized businesses looking for versatility.
Best For:
Budget-friendly marketing, SMBs, and businesses needing multi-channel communication (Email + SMS + WhatsApp).

5. GetResponse

GetResponse is a full-fledged marketing platform designed to support businesses of all sizes with email campaigns, automation, and funnel building. It is considered one of the top email marketing platforms because of its advanced features like webinars, landing pages, and powerful automation flows. The platform offers an intuitive drag-and-drop email creator with dozens of templates, making it easy to design professional campaigns. GetResponse’s automation builder is one of the most advanced in the market, helping you design complex workflows based on triggers such as purchases, clicks, page visits, and engagement level. Its Conversion Funnel feature allows businesses to create complete sales funnels, from landing pages to email sequences, in minutes.
GetResponse also offers eCommerce integrations with Shopify, WooCommerce, and BigCommerce, making it ideal for online stores. With strong deliverability, detailed analytics, and 24/7 support, GetResponse is a perfect choice for growing businesses seeking scalability and performance in their marketing campaigns.
Best For:
Businesses need funnels, webinars, and advanced automation for scaling marketing operations.
6. ActiveCampaign

ActiveCampaign is known for offering the most advanced automation capabilities among all top email marketing platforms. It is built for businesses that want deep segmentation, intelligent workflows, and personalized messaging at scale. Its visual automation builder is incredibly detailed, allowing you to create complex customer journeys based on behaviour, purchase activity, website visits, or engagement triggers. ActiveCampaign’s machine learning features help predict user actions and improve campaign performance. The platform also offers CRM functionality, making it ideal for sales-driven businesses that want to manage leads and automate follow-ups. Its email templates are professional and customizable, and the drag-and-drop builder is easy to use.
ActiveCampaign integrates seamlessly with Shopify, WordPress, Salesforce, and more. Deliverability rates are consistently high, ensuring emails reach inboxes reliably. Although it has a learning curve, ActiveCampaign is perfect for businesses seeking enterprise-level automation and personalization without needing a separate CRM or marketing system.
Best For:
Advanced automation, CRM-driven teams, and businesses that want deep segmentation and personalization.
